Marathon is back after a 30-year hiatus, but how does it play? We give you the lowdown on its graphics, gameplay, and more, fresh off the recent server slam.
Chris Maddison was just an intern when he started working on the Go-playing AI that would eventually become AlphaGo. A decade later, he talks about that match against Lee Sedol and what came next ...
Ruby is an incredibly easy language to learn, and there's a lot of evidence why it is simple to break into and start.
Today, serious trading runs on systems. Decisions are written in code. Orders are triggered automatically.
Using an AI coding assistant to migrate an application from one programming language to another wasn’t as easy as it looked. Here are three takeaways.